Administrative Officer 2

Are you ready to support programs that help communities recover and prepare for emergencies across Pennsylvania? Join the Pennsylvania Emergency Management Agency (PEMA) as an Administrative Officer 2 and strengthen critical disaster recovery and preparedness programs. This position plays a key role in helping communities access important state and federal resources. You will work with partners at many levels of government while supporting program operations.

This is an ideal role for someone who enjoys detailed work that reinforces public safety — apply today!

This position helps manage state and federal disaster recovery and emergency preparedness grant programs. Through your work, you will support communities by ensuring that funding is used correctly and follows required guidelines. As an Administrative Officer 2, you will perform the following duties:

  • Grant Oversight: Review and evaluate applications, reimbursement requests, and program activities for compliance with federal and state rules
  • Policy Development: Create and update policies, procedures, and guidelines used to administer disaster recovery and emergency preparedness grants
  • Program Monitoring: Track subrecipient grant balances, prepare status reports, and ensure all reporting requirements are met
  • Training Support: Assist in creating and delivering training related to grant administration and program requirements
  • Agreement Management: Develop grant agreements, process approvals, and maintain accurate records throughout the grant cycle
  • Communication Tasks: Prepare correspondence, respond to inquiries, and maintain strong working relationships with federal, state, county, and local partners

Work Schedule and Additional Information:

  • Full-time employment
  • Work hours are 8:00 AM to 4:00 PM, Monday - Friday, with a 30-minute lunch.
  • In the event of an emergency/disaster situation or training exercise, this position may be required to travel, work up to 12-hour shifts, and work outside of the normal work hours, including weekends and overnights.
  • Telework: You may have the opportunity to work from home (telework) part-time, upon successful completion of the training period. In order to telework, you must have a securely configured high-speed internet connection and work from an approved location inside Pennsylvania. If you are unable to telework, you will have the option to report to the headquarters office in Harrisburg. The ability to telework is subject to change at any time.

    Additional details may be provided during the interview.
  • Salary: Selected candidates who are new to employment with the Commonwealth of Pennsylvania will begin employment at the starting annual salary of $59,345.00 (before taxes).
  • Free and secure on-site parking.

Minimum Experience and Training Requirements:

  • One year as an Administrative Officer 1 (Commonwealth job title or equivalent Federal Government job title, as determined by the Office of Administration); or
  • Three years of experience in progressively responsible and varied office management or staff work, including experience in personnel management, budgeting, or procurement; and a bachelor's degree; or
  • Any equivalent combination of experience and training.

Other Requirements:

  • You must meet the PA residency requirement. For more information on ways to meet PA residency requirements, follow the link and click on Residency Guidelines.
  • You must be able to perform essential job functions.
